The article considers the integrated approach to professional training of future music and pedagogicalworkers. The ideas of aesthetic education and music education are combined. It is noted that aesthetic taste isthe willingness of music teachers to analyze and perceive the beautiful, determine the aesthetic value of musicalworks, break the aesthetic perception through the mechanisms of performing works of musical art, to educatestudents in aesthetic culture.The purpose of the article is a theoretical substantiation of the method of education of aesthetic taste infuture music and pedagogical workers by means of vocal skills. The research methodology is a competency approach. The novelty is the method of educating aesthetic tastein future music and pedagogical workers by means of vocal skills. Methodology is an algorithm and proceduresfor updating the content of education, the use of variable methods and forms, means of educational work. Theformation of the ability to aesthetic taste occurs in the process of teaching vocal skills. At the emotionalmotivationalstage, the connection of the motivational sphere with emotions, which is essential in the profession,is revealed. Peculiarities of the content-executive stage of the method are updating the content of vocal trainingby supplementing psychological and pedagogical knowledge about aesthetic taste.There is an improvement of skills of concert-performing, compositional, conducting, musicological,research, pedagogical, sound-directing, managerial activities in the field of musical art by means of vocal skills.The content of the reflexive-controlling stage of the method is one’s own thoughts and experiences, doubtsand beliefs in one’s own correct actions, analysis of one’s own mental and moral state, feeling of aestheticpleasure and harmony, control and restraint of one’s emotions, self-knowledge and self-regulation.The practical significance of the method is that the level of formation of aesthetic taste of future musicand pedagogical workers increases. This affects the quality of performance of musical works, creative selfexpression,recognition of talents by grateful spectators.
